Why is Chrome blocking content?

Why is Google Chrome blocking websites

If Google Chrome blocks a site automatically, it may be because Google deems that site unsafe, or because your employer or school has chosen to prevent access to that site, so you should proceed with caution.

Why can’t I access some websites

If you are unable to access some websites on your device, your device administrator or internet service provider has likely blocked them. If websites are not blocked but still refuse to open, it could be due to IP address blockage, misconfigured proxy settings, delayed DNS response, or some browser-specific problem.

Why is my browser blocking all websites

Why do websites get blocked Websites get blocked when they detect an IP address that isn't supposed to access the restricted content. Your IP (Internet Protocol) address identifies your device on the internet and reveals your physical location. That's what lets websites find your IP and block (or allow) your device.

How do I unblock protected content in Chrome

If protected content is blocked, you might get an error and the content won't play.On your computer, open Chrome.At the top right, click More. Settings.Click Privacy and security. Site Settings.Click Additional content settings. Protected content IDs.Select the option below "Default behavior" that you want.

How do I unblock censored sites

One of the easiest ways to unblock websites is with a public web proxy. It may not be as fast or secure as a VPN, but a public web proxy is a good option when you use public PCs that don't let you install a VPN. Proxies hide your IP address and route your internet traffic through different public servers.

How do I remove content blocker from Chrome

Turn off the ad blockerAt the top right, click More. Settings.Click Privacy and security. Site Settings.Click Additional content settings. Ads.Turn off Block ads on sites that show intrusive or misleading ads.

How do I unblock a website permission

Change settings for a siteOn your Android phone or tablet, open Chrome .Go to a site.To the left of the address bar, tap Lock. Permissions.Tap the permission you want to update. To change a setting, select it. To clear the site's settings, tap Reset permissions.
